It teaches us that the highest 10 (achieve) often comes after the hardest climb. 【答案】 1.greatest 2.Surprisingly 3.wrote 4.with 5.ways 6.to enjoy 7.Although/Though 8.themselves 9.an 10.achievement 【导语】本文是一篇介绍黄山的说明文,讲述了黄山的自然景观、历史渊源、游览方式,以及现代发展带来的争议,最终点明 “最艰难的攀登后,往往能收获最高的成就” 这一道理。 1.句意:它是中国最伟大的自然奇观之一。“one of the+形容词最高级+可数名词复数” 是固定结构,表示“最……之一”,故great变为最高级greatest。 2.句意:令人惊讶的是,这座山在每个季节看起来都不同。此处需要副词修饰整个句子,surprising变为副词Surprisingly(句首首字母大写)。 3.句意:然后他写道:“游览过黄山后,便没有哪座山值得一看了。”时间状语“In the Ming Dynasty”表明动作发生在过去,故write变为过去式wrote。 4.句意:一些游客不得不应对身体上的困难。固定搭配deal with表示“处理、应对”,故填介词with。 5.句意:如今,游客可以选择不同的方式欣赏这座山。different后接可数名词复数,故way变为复数ways。 6.句意:新缆车让游客不必走太多路就能欣赏黄山的美景。固定搭配allow sb. to do sth.表示“允许某人做某事”,故填to enjoy。 7.句意:虽然它节省时间,但无法提供真正攀登的乐趣。此处引导让步状语从句,表示“虽然、尽管”,故填Although/Though。 8.句意:他们说这会让人们忘记如何挑战自我。challenge oneself表示“挑战自我”,主语是people,故they变为反身代词themselves。 9.句意:无论我们坐缆车还是一步步走,黄山都留给我们一段不寻常的经历。experience是可数名词。意为“经历”,unusual以元音音素开头,故用不定冠词an,表示“一段经历”。 10.句意:它教会我们,最高的成就往往在最艰难的攀登之后到来。the highest后接名词,achieve变为名词achievement,表示“成就”。 二、阅读理解 (25-26八年级下·贵州六盘水·期中) The Dead Sea is one of the saltiest places on earth. Although it is a lake, it is called a “sea” due to its lack of fresh water. Why is the Dead Sea so salty? One reason is that it is about 430.5 meters below sea level. A long time ago, salt water flowed into the Dead Sea. Now, water from the Jordan River flows into the Dead Sea. With no outlet (出口),  the water evaporates (蒸发) under the hot sun, leaving salt behind. Scientists say that the Dead Sea is falling. Its water level is dropping by 3.3 feet per year. People are using more water from the river. Less fresh water enters the lake every year. Lakes are usually filled with life. But the Dead Sea lives up to its name. Nothing lives there. There are no plants. No birds or animals can drink the water. If fish from the river swim into the Dead Sea by mistake, they will die. The water kills almost everything. It is saltier than ocean water. People like to visit this lake. There are hotels and beaches. People like to float (漂浮) on the salt water. The salt water holds them up as if they were lying on rafts (木筏)! Some tourists even like to read books as they float on the water. They are covered with salt when they come out of the water. 阅读下列短文,从每题所给的A、B、C三个选项中选出最佳选项。 1.Why do people call the Dead Sea a “sea”?
